A Continuous Time Framework for Discrete Denoising Models
Andrew Campbell1、Joe Benton1、Valentin De Bortoli2 Tom Rainforth1、George Deligiannidis1、Arnaud Doucet1
Abstract
We provide the first complete continuous time framework for denoising diffusion models of discrete data. This is achieved by formulating the forward noising process and corresponding reverse time generative process as Continuous Time Markov Chains (CTMCs). The model can be efficiently trained using a continuous time version of the ELBO. We simulate the high dimensional CTMC using techniques developed in chemical physics and exploit our continuous time framework to derive high performance samplers that we show can outperform discrete time methods for discrete data. The continuous time treatment also enables us to derive a novel theoretical result bounding the error between the generated sample distribution and the true data distribution.
中文速览
离散数据(文本、图像像素值、音乐音符等)的扩散生成模型此前只能在离散时间步下训练和采样,这限制了采样灵活性、理论分析能力和生成质量。本文将离散数据的去噪扩散过程完整地建立在连续时间框架下:把前向加噪和反向生成都表示为连续时间马尔可夫链(Continuous Time Markov Chain, CTMC),推导出对应的连续时间证据下界(ELBO)用于高效训练,并借鉴化学物理中的tau-leaping技术设计了一种新型预测-校正采样器来高效模拟高维反向过程。理论上,该框架还首次给出了离散状态生成分布与真实数据分布之间误差的定量上界。在CIFAR-10图像和单声部音乐序列的实验中,新采样器的生成质量超越了此前所有离散时间离散状态方法,大幅缩小了离散数据建模与连续数据建模之间的性能差距,为离散生成模型提供了一套理论完备、实践高效的新基础。
